A PA visit follows the same format as a physician visit: health history, physical exam, diagnosis, and treatment plan. PAs can order labs, imaging, and referrals. They prescribe medications in all 50 states. Appointments typically last 15 to 30 minutes. PAs consult with the supervising physician for complex or unusual cases. In surgical practices, the PA may see you for pre-op and post-op visits while the surgeon performs the procedure.
You might see a PA in virtually any medical setting: primary care, urgent care, the emergency department, a surgical practice, or a specialty clinic. PAs handle routine visits, sick appointments, chronic disease management, pre-operative evaluations, minor procedures (suturing, joint injections, biopsies), and post-surgical follow-ups. In surgical specialties, PAs often perform the initial consultation and assist during surgery. If you are seen in an urgent care clinic or ER, there is a good chance your provider will be a PA.

All insurance plans cover PA visits at the same copay level as physician visits. Medicare reimburses PA services at 85% of the physician fee schedule, but your copay is based on the allowed amount and remains the same. PAs are listed in insurance provider directories. PA-performed procedures (suturing, biopsies, joint injections) are covered the same as when performed by a physician.
